# Typelark Environments — Vendored Fonts

Quick note for whoever inherits this: Typelark vendors all third-party fonts into the repo rather than pulling them at build time. Yes, it bloats the tree, but it saved us twice when upstream foundries yanked releases. Dev and staging share the same font bundle; production uses a stripped subset to keep cold starts fast. If you add a font, update all three manifests. Each environment's current settings appear below.

service settings:
[oliax]
host = oliax.qorvelcorp.internal
user = oliax_svc
database = oliax_prod

### Encoding Detection

The Glyphsense endpoint inspects uploaded text files and returns the detected encoding plus a confidence score. Files over 8 MB are sampled from the first 64 KB. UTF-8 with BOM is normalized before detection. Responses include a fallback suggestion when confidence is below 0.7. All calls go through the internal Charmap service and must be authenticated with the key below.

gateway credential: kto7_GoY89Me

Prefetcher runbook — TileHound. If prefetch queue depth exceeds 50k, the Marwick region scheduler is likely stalled. Restart the scheduler pod first; do not flush the tile cache unless queue depth keeps climbing after restart. Check zoom-level 14–16 hit rates before paging anyone. Full triage steps are on the internal page below.

operations page: https://jenkins.zemvarcloud.local/job/merge_requests/repo/build/73930b4b30f0a8ed

GraphSpindle renders dependency graphs for internal builds. Read-only access by default. Parser runs sandboxed; lockfiles are untrusted input. Do not grant the renderer network egress. Threat model doc lives in the security wiki under GraphSpindle. Review checklist: input validation, SVG sanitization, cache poisoning. Report any finding before merging. For scope questions, contact the review coordinator.

alerts address for kajog-tadup: druox@plorvanet.internal